Is SROs armed?

Are school resource officers usually armed?

Yes

. A school resource officer is a commissioned, sworn law enforcement officer, not a “security guard.” NASRO recommends that all SROs be issued and carry all the same equipment they’d have on any other law enforcement assignment.

When did the SRO program start?

The First School Resource Officer Program

In

the late 1950’s

, the first SRO program was started in Flint, Michigan. It’s overall goal was to improve the relationship between local police and youth. Officers were placed in schools on a full time basis for the first time ever. They served as teachers and counselors.
